Core Capabilities In Bellingham

Operations in Bellingham emphasize coordination with harbor authorities, ferry terminals, and downtown business districts. Teams work standard shifts and extended event coverage to match waterfront schedules and seasonal demand.

Licensing, background checks, and ongoing training align with Washington state requirements. Equipment such as radios, cameras, and lighting is selected for reliability in wet conditions and variable visibility.

Risk Assessment Strategies

Security professionals conduct site visits, review incident logs, and map choke points across properties and public access areas. They evaluate theft, vandalism, unauthorized boating, and crowd dynamics during festivals.

Recommendations often include lighting upgrades, signage, access control points, and staff briefings tailored to local crime patterns and maritime hazards.

Event Planning And Coordination

Pre-Event Planning

Security teams collaborate early with organizers to define perimeters, staffing levels, communication channels, and evacuation routes. They align plans with city permits, marine forecasts, and traffic flow near the water.

Onsite Management

During the event, teams manage entry queues, monitor CCTV, patrol sensitive zones, and coordinate with medical and fire responders. Clear reporting ensures rapid adjustment if conditions change on the waterfront.

Choosing Local Security Resources

Selecting partners familiar with Bellingham’s port activity, ferry traffic, and seasonal tourism creates smoother operations and safer outcomes for clients and visitors alike.

  • Verify state licensing and local marine patrol certifications
  • Review incident response times specific to waterfront locations
  • Confirm technology compatibility with city monitoring systems
  • Request tailored plans that address tides, weather, and event scale
  • Establish clear communication channels with law enforcement and port authorities
